Handover — Drystack FD leak hunt. Status: narrowed to the metrics flusher; sockets aren't closed on retry. Repro: run soak test 2h, watch lsof count climb. Fix branch is half done; do not ship 4.2 without it. Release manager: hold the train until the soak passes clean. Debug tooling lives in the sealed ops vault on the Harrowgate box. Unseal it with the recovery passphrase below.

unlock words, hahip-yagef: zorok-novmir-zorix-silax

Subject: Handover — thumbgen queue release duty

Taking over Friday. Thumbgen queue on Pixelroute is stable; backlog alarms fire at 10k pending jobs. If workers stall, redeploy from the last tagged image — don't roll schema. Release artifacts must be signed or the deploy hook rejects them; CI signs on tag. If you need to verify a build manually before pushing, use the deploy key below.

release key, hadug-kawef: bky13_mPGeFZeR1GZ1G

// Future maintainers: this limit exists because the preview stage holds
// every parsed row in memory to run column-type inference, and imports
// beyond this size caused the worker pool to thrash under the old
// Thistledown deployment. Raising it requires moving inference to the
// streaming path first — see the wizard refactor notes. Validation
// behavior also differs for quoted multiline fields, so test those
// explicitly. This constant was last benchmarked on the build stamped
// immediately below.

pipeline stamp: htk31_f769b577b3028a4e9958e5bb8d1259a